#e0dbf3 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e0dbf3 is composed of 87.8% red, 85.9% green and 95.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 7.8% cyan, 9.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 4.7% black. It has a hue angle of 252.5 degrees, a saturation of 50% and a lightness of 90.6%. #e0dbf3 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#c1b7e7. Closest websafe color is: #ccccff.

#e0dbf3 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e0dbf3 has RGB values of R:224, G:219, B:243 and CMYK values of C:0.08, M:0.1, Y:0, K:0.05. Its decimal value is 14736371.
